Description:
Discover the outdoors and learn about wildlife in
the parks at night! Bring your family, sense of adventure and a flashlight to this
1.5 hour fall hike with Ranger Angel Ray. We’ll look for and learn about critters
stirring and other nocturnal animals as we hike around Betty’s Lake in the park.
Wear closed-toe shoes, and bring a water bottle and bug repellent, if desired.
Children must be accompanied by an adult. Pre-registration is required.
